Frost Advisory Tonight – Wednesday Morning

[ad_1]

PORTLAND, Oregon — Day two of our cooler weather pattern.  Today will be drier than Monday, although a spotty shower chance continues in the forecast.  Skies will be partly cloudy with cool northwest breezes 5-15 mph.  The snow level over the Cascades for flurries will be 3,000 to 4,000 feet. 

A Frost Advisory and Freeze Warning is up for western Oregon and southwest Washington for Tuesday overnight into Wednesday morning.  Widespread temperatures in the mid 30s and colder are expected.  Many areas will drop to 32 degrees.  Despite the chilly start, sunny skies will warm Wednesday afternoon temps into the 60s. 

Thursday and Friday will be even warmer as the clear weather continues. Looks for valley highs warming back into the 70s. 

Our weekend forecast is uncertain as some weather models show a chance of rain both days.
